summ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Simon McVittie <smcv@collabora.com>2023-01-20 14:20:25 +0000
committerSimon McVittie <smcv@collabora.com>2023-01-20 15:13:35 +0000
commitf1d05153b943b6c46192323ead096d5ca177f99e (patch)
tree35fa497ba92828ba889a4a0deb97f208ee2df4c1
parent5a6df5a102227d1c34f1be6b3b2ac40782fe3d19 (diff)
downloaddbus-python-wip/smcv/build.tar.gz
ci-install.sh: Roll back to an older version of ninja on EOL Debian 10wip/smcv/build
Signed-off-by: Simon McVittie <smcv@collabora.com>
-rwxr-xr-xtools/ci-install.sh6
1 files changed, 4 insertions, 2 deletions
diff --git a/tools/ci-install.sh b/tools/ci-install.sh
index ea3a24e..ca678ed 100755
--- a/tools/ci-install.sh
+++ b/tools/ci-install.sh
@@ -127,10 +127,12 @@ case "$ci_distro" in
case "$ci_suite" in
(buster|focal)
+ ninja=ninja==1.10.2.4
;;
(*)
$sudo apt-get -qq -y install meson
+ ninja=ninja
have_system_meson=true
;;
esac
@@ -162,9 +164,9 @@ esac
if [ -n "$have_system_meson" ]; then
:
elif [ -n "${dbus_ci_system_python-}" ]; then
- "$dbus_ci_system_python" -m pip install --user meson ninja
+ "$dbus_ci_system_python" -m pip install --user meson $ninja
else
- pip install meson ninja
+ pip install meson $ninja
fi
# vim:set sw=4 sts=4 et: